Detailed Description

Histogramming package.

Author
Volker Blobel, University Hamburg, 2005-2009 (initial Fortran77 version)
Claus Kleinwort, DESY (maintenance and developement)
                          HMP... and GMP...
                    Histogram and XY data in text files

     Booking:

     CALL HMPDEF(IH,XA,XB,TEXT)               CALL GMPDEF(IG,ITYP,TEXT)
     where                                    where
        IH    = 1 ... 10                         IG    = 1 ... 10
        XA,XB = left, right limit                ITYP  = 1 dots
        TEXT  = explanation                            = 2 line
                                                       = 3 dots and line
                                                       = 4 symbols
                                                       = 5 mean/sigma
                                                 TEXT  = explanation

     CALL HMPLUN(LUNW)                        CALL GMPLUN(LUNW)
     unit for output                          unit for output

     CALL HMPENT(IH,X)                        CALL GMPXY(IG,X,Y)
     entry flt.pt. X                          add (X,Y) pair

                                              CALL GMPXYD(IG,X,Y,DX,DY)
                                              add (X,Y,DX,DY) ITYP=4

        new                                   CALL GMPMS(IG,X,Y)
                                              mean/sigma from x,y

     Booking log integer histogram:

     CALL HMPLDF(IH,TEXT)
     book and reset log integer histogram

     CALL HMPLNT(IH,IX)
     entry integer IX

     Printing and writing:

     CALL HMPRNT(IH)                          CALL GMPRNT(IG)
     print histogram IH or all, if 0          print data Ig or all, if 0

     CALL HMPWRT(IH)                          CALL GMPWRT(IG)
     write histogram IH or all to file        write data IG or all to file


     Storage manager for GMP...

      CALL STMARS(NDIM)           !! init/reset  storage manager, partially dynamic

      CALL STMAPR(JFLC,X,Y)       !! store pair (X,Y)

      CALL STMADP(JFLC,FOUR)      !! store double pair

      CALL STMACP(JFLC,ARRAY,N)   !! copy (cp) all pairs to array

      CALL STMARM(JFLC)           !! remove (rm) stored paiirs

The number of histograms is limited to NUMHIS (=15), the number of XY data plots to NUMGXY (=10) and the storage of XY points to NDIM (=5000). As each XY plot can contain up to NLIMIT (=500) points (before averaging) NDIM should be NLIMIT*NUMGXY.
